Two questions:

1) What version of Photoshop are you using?

2) How do you get the individual scans to combine into one file?

I'm using Photoshop 7 but I'm only using it for two functions. I found
that in many cases OCR software does better from an already scanned page
than it does inputing directly from the scanner. Even more so in some
cases if I do a bit of correction to the image. You've probably seen
papers that a scan or photocopy yields a distinctly dark gray result.
So I take a look at the results of a scan before OCRing it and if say
the  paper comes out grayish I'll use "Curves" to adjust it to black
text on a white background.

The other place Photoshop comes into it is because my OCR software
doesn't do well with images I use Photoshop to to deal with the images
that I past into the text document.

I don't combine the individual scans. I work with each page separately
and turn them into a single page PDF. Then I use Acrobat to combine the
pages.
